The Maker Movement

The Maker Movement is a cultural trend that emphasizes creativity, hands-on learning, and the DIY (do-it-yourself) ethos. It encourages individuals to design, create, and share their own projects using various tools and technologies, such as 3D printers, electronics, and woodworking tools. Makerspaces, which are community workshops, provide access to resources and equipment for people of all ages to collaborate and innovate. This movement promotes skills like problem-solving and critical thinking, fostering a community of creators who value self-expression and ingenuity in technology and crafts.
